Introduction
In today’s digital landscape, the power of artificial intelligence (AI) is reshaping industries and revolutionizing various aspects of our lives. Web development, being a crucial part of the online world, is not exempt from the transformative capabilities of AI. As businesses strive to deliver exceptional user experiences, enhance efficiency, and stay ahead of the competition, incorporating AI into web development has become a strategic imperative. In this article, we will explore the vast potential of AI in shaping the future of web development.
Understanding AI in Web Development
AI refers to the simulation of human intelligence in machines that are capable of learning, reasoning, and performing tasks autonomously. When it comes to web development, AI technologies enable developers to build smarter, more intuitive, and highly personalized websites and applications. By leveraging AI algorithms, developers can automate repetitive tasks, analyze vast amounts of data, and generate valuable insights, leading to enhanced user experiences and increased business outcomes.
Enhancing User Experience with AI
One of the primary goals of web development is to provide exceptional user experiences. AI plays a pivotal role in achieving this objective by enabling websites and applications to understand and adapt to user preferences. With AI-powered chatbots and virtual assistants, businesses can offer personalized assistance and real-time interactions, creating a more engaging and user-friendly environment. Additionally, AI algorithms can analyze user behavior, preferences, and patterns to deliver tailored content, recommendations, and search results, further enhancing user satisfaction.
Automation and Efficiency
AI-powered automation is revolutionizing web development by streamlining processes and increasing efficiency. Tasks that were traditionally time-consuming and resource-intensive can now be automated, allowing developers to focus on more strategic initiatives. AI-based tools and frameworks enable rapid prototyping, code generation, and testing, significantly reducing development cycles. Furthermore, AI algorithms can automatically detect and fix bugs, optimize performance, and ensure the security and scalability of web applications.
Data Analysis and Insights
Data is a valuable asset in web development, providing crucial insights into user behavior, market trends, and business performance. AI algorithms can analyze vast amounts of data in real-time, uncover hidden patterns, and generate actionable insights. By harnessing the power of AI, developers can gain a deeper understanding of user preferences, optimize conversion rates, and make data-driven decisions for website improvements. AI-driven analytics also enable businesses to anticipate user needs, personalize marketing campaigns, and stay ahead in a competitive landscape.
The Role of AI in SEO
Search engine optimization (SEO) is vital for web developers seeking to enhance the visibility and ranking of their websites in search engine results. AI-powered tools can analyze search engine algorithms, identify keywords, and suggest optimized content strategies. Natural language processing (NLP) algorithms can analyze user search queries, enabling developers to create relevant and high-quality content that aligns with user intent. AI-driven SEO tools also provide insights into competitors’ strategies, backlink analysis, and website performance metrics, empowering developers to make informed decisions and optimize their websites for better search engine rankings.
AI and the Possible Future of Web Development
As AI continues to advance, the future of web development holds tremendous possibilities. Here are some key areas where AI is expected to have a significant impact:
- Voice-Activated Interfaces: With the rise of voice assistants like Siri and Alexa, voice-activated interfaces are becoming increasingly popular. AI-powered natural language processing and voice recognition technologies will play a vital role in developing seamless voice-activated web experiences.
- Machine Learning: Machine learning algorithms enable websites and applications to continuously learn from user interactions and adapt accordingly. This allows for highly personalized experiences, predictive analytics, and automated decision-making.
- Virtual Reality (VR) and Augmented Reality (AR): AI-driven technologies like VR and AR have the potential to revolutionize web development by creating immersive and interactive experiences. From virtual showrooms to augmented product demonstrations, AI-powered VR and AR will reshape how users engage with websites and applications.
- Cybersecurity: AI algorithms can detect and mitigate potential security threats, protecting websites and applications from unauthorized access, malware, and other cyber attacks. AI-powered security systems continuously monitor and analyze user behavior, network traffic, and system vulnerabilities to ensure robust protection.
- Data-driven Personalization: AI algorithms will continue to evolve, enabling web developers to provide hyper-personalized experiences to users. From personalized product recommendations to dynamic pricing strategies, AI-driven personalization will be a cornerstone of future web development.
The Future of AI in Web Development: What’s Next?
As AI continues to advance, it is likely to play an increasingly important role in web development and other areas of the tech industry. Some predictions for the future of AI in web development include:
- Continued growth and evolution: As AI technologies become more sophisticated and accessible, it is expected that they will be increasingly adopted in web development and other fields.
- The importance of staying up-to-date: As AI technologies continue to evolve, it will be important for web developers and other professionals to stay up-to-date with the latest developments and best practices. This will help ensure that they are able to take advantage of the benefits that AI has to offer, while also addressing any potential challenges.
AI has the potential to revolutionize the way we interact with websites and apps. By using machine learning, natural language processing, and computer vision, we can create more personalized and efficient experiences for users.
However, it is important to ensure that AI is used ethically and responsibly, taking into account issues such as accuracy, fairness, and user data privacy. The future of AI in web development is exciting, and it will be important for professionals to stay up-to-date with the latest developments to stay ahead of the curve.
Conclusion
AI is rapidly transforming the field of web development, empowering developers to create smarter, more intuitive, and highly personalized websites and applications. By leveraging AI technologies, businesses can enhance user experiences, automate processes, analyze data, and stay ahead of the competition. As the future unfolds, the power of AI will continue to unleash new possibilities, revolutionizing the way we interact with the web. Embracing AI in web development is not just an option but a necessity for businesses looking to thrive in the digital era.